2012-05-04 7 views
0

select(SelectionType)クラスのQTextCursorには、4つのパラメータしかありません。Qt:カスタムQTextCursorを選択します。

QTextCursor::Document 
QTextCursor::BlockUnderCursor 
QTextCursor::LineUnderCursor 
QTextCursor::WordUnderCursor 

カスタムセレクションタイプを作成することはできますか? 5から9までのテキストを選択したいとします。ありがとう!このような

http://doc.qt.io/qt-5/qtextcursor.html#select

答えて

3

使用setPosition

cursor.setPosition(5); 
cursor.setPosition(9, QTextCursor::KeepAnchor); 

これは、選択はアンカーと位置の間のテキストである9に5のカーソルのアンカーとその位置を設定します。

関連する問題